Right, by going through some more of the AFC and PCC files; i've found some more "Revealing" evidence:
On a fresh installation some file are included - namely: E:\Program Files\Mass Effect 2\BioGame\CookedPC\BioD_CitHub_DLC_500Thief.pcc - 1.70 KB (1,744 bytes)
When the DLC for Zaeed is installed this file gets installed on your computer: E:\Program Files\Mass Effect 2\BioGame\DLC\DLC_HEN_VT\CookedPC\BioD_OmgHub_DLC_Veteran.pcc - 1.57 MB (1,651,128 bytes)
The same applies to Kasumi: E:\Program Files\Mass Effect 2\BioGame\DLC\DLC_HEN_MT\CookedPC\BioD_CitHub_DLC_500Thief.pcc - 655 KB (671,258 bytes)
now as you can see - the files become larger and are stored in the BioGame\DLC folder of your installation directory.
Now that we have that bit out of the way, this is the interesting part: BioD_TwrHub_500Liara.pcc - 1.31 KB (1,349 bytes)
Now, guide your attention to the file at the end: "BioD_TwrHub_504LiaraDLC.pcc"
Notice, if you will, the "DLC" on the end of the file name...
Now make up your own minds...
